If you've got a stack of PLR (private label rights content) sitting on your hard drive, but you aren't sure what to do with it - here's some help for you. With a few creative plans, you can take a good chunk of that PLR content and easily create something new and fresh from it.
Create an ebook Assuming youve collected quite a chunk of PLR on a niche topic this content can be organized to create chapters for a book. Once youve organized and edited your PLR into book format, hire a graphic artist to create cover graphics and youre good to go.
Distribute the eBooks to anyone you choose, on your websites, blogs or through an online book reseller like Amazon books for example. You can even create a series of ebooks or offer consistently more advanced information, so your customers will come back for more.
Special Reports. Special reports are shorter, very topic specific documents that generally help people do something or solve a problem. You can bundle up a few articles and offer special reports as a free gift to your readers or give them as a gift for signing up for your newsletter. Add an introduction and conclusion written by you to make your report unique to your business. You can even use these reports to promote your own products or insert affiliate links for extra income.
Online Education. Using the same concept, you can organize your collection of PLR content into lessons which can be distributed to your email subscriber list. The lessons provide a viable means for promoting your other products and services. Theyre also useful for promoting and recommending affiliate products.
